Hello,

I am trying to install FreeBSD 5.2 on Compaq Presario R3000T laptop
PC. The boot process starts and I get a menu with the seven opotions
on it. When I select 1 to start the boot process, my system shuts
down. This is happening with other options also.

I have tried the same CD on other systems and they are booting up
properly to start the install process.

I have installed Linux on my system and it is working fine. So am sure
that there are no hardware failures.

Can anyone suggest why this is happening and what can be done to
correct it?
